Louis Masankha Banda was born and raised in Malawi. He received his Bachelor of Science degree in Statistics and Demography from University of Malawi, Chancellor College in 2009. Before enrolling in a Masters in Biostatistics, he worked with Millennium Villages Project in the area of project monitoring and evaluation. Currently, Louis is pursuing a Master of Science degree in Biostatistics at Chancellor College in Zomba, Malawi. Until he joined the GHC fellowship, Louis worked as a Demonstrator in the Department of Mathematical Sciences at Chancellor College, where he was involved in delivering Statistics and Mathematics tutorials to the first year undergraduate students. In 2007, while still an undergraduate student, he did a voluntary job with Invest in Knowledge Initiative (IKI) where he was involved in the design, data collection and handling of a pilot study determining trends, determinants and implications of VCT/ART uptake in rural Malawi. Louis has a strong zeal for developing his research and data management skills further in the area of public health.
